Frequently asked questions
What is com chay cha bong?
Com chay cha bong, also known as Vietnamese crispy rice cakes with shredded pork, is a traditional Vietnamese snack. It is made of leftover rice which is dried and then deep-fried until crispy and is typically served with a shredded pork topping.
How does com chay cha bong taste?
The rice cake is crunchy and the shredded pork adds a savory flavor. It can be slightly sweet, depending on the preparation.
Are there any allergens in com chay cha bong?
It can contain allergens such as shrimp and gluten, depending on the ingredients used in preparation. Always check the label if you have food allergies.

What is the shelf life of com chay cha bong?
When stored properly, com chay cha bong can last for up to a week in the fridge.
What nutritional value does com chay cha bong have?
Com chay cha bong is high in carbohydrates, sodium, and fat. It can be high in protein as well due to the shredded pork.
Which dishes can be paired with com chay cha bong?
Com chay cha bong can be served as a snack on its own or used as a topping for soups, salads, and other dishes.
Is it gluten-free?
Com chay cha bong itself is gluten-free if prepared using rice and pork. However, be aware of any added sauces or seasoning which may contain gluten.
What is it used for?
It is typically used as a snack or as a topping for various dishes for added crispiness and flavor.
Where does com chay cha bong originate from?
Com chay cha bong originates from Vietnam.
Is it suitable for vegetarians?
No, com chay cha bong includes shredded pork, which is not suitable for vegetarians.
Can I make my own com chay cha bong at home?
Yes, you can make your own com chay cha bong at home if you have the necessary ingredients and cooking equipment.
Can I freeze com chay cha bong?
Yes, you can freeze it for long-term storage. Just make sure to package it in airtight containers or bag.
Is com chay cha bong spicy?
Traditionally com chay cha bong is not spicy, but it can be infused with chilies or made spicy based on personal preferences.
What are the key ingredients for making com chay cha bong?
The key ingredients for making com chay cha bong are leftover rice, pork fat, and shredded pork.
Is com chay cha bong high in calories?
Yes, due to the frying process and the shredded pork topping, com chay cha bong can be high in calories.
